Charging and Dedicating Stones and Crystals
Charging (or programming) is the term used for establishing temporary intent- for example, you use a piece of amethyst for a restful sleep spell, and later cleanse it and charge it to use for meditation. Perhaps you use a piece of tigerâs-eye for a prosperity spell, and use it again in the future for a grounding ritual. This method of cleansing and charging over and over again is perfectly fine.
However, you may wish to keep a particular stone or piece of jewelry for one purpose. In this case, use dedication- your intent to use this piece permanently (for an extended period of time) for a singular purpose- a protective amulet, for example, or a crystal ball for divination.
Methods of Charging and Dedicating
The most important thing to remember when charging is to clearly visualize your intent. See what you want; focus on your goal. Ideally, youâll use the same (or similar) visualization during the spell or ritual to reinforce your intent. Hold the stone in your projective hand during the charging process or hold your projective hand over the stone(s). It may help you to speak your intent out loud or even write it down on paper and place the stone on top. If you have several stones to use for a spell, you can charge them together, even if they serve slightly different purposes. They will be united by your goal in the spell.
Also, remember to consider your need; your goal with a spell may be general or specific. For example, rather than focusing on general prosperity, you can focus on your specific need, such as paying off debts or making more money. You could also use a visualization where you can see yourself in a situation you desire. In some situations, you need to remain general and open, such as when seeking love. Donât neglect how you might limit yourself- think of it kind of like surfing the Internet: when youâre doing a search, sometimes your need to be very specific but other times you want all the options revealed to you.

Other Methods
Just as sounds can be used to clear energy, they can help with programming and dedicating as well. Play a particular type of music when youâre visualizing your intent. You will come to associate this sound with that stone and your purpose. You can also use bells, singing bowls, drums, or other instruments.
If you work with essential oils, you may wish to add a few drops of oil to a carrier solution and apply this to a crystal. Again, use caution that the stone wonât be damaged. Choose a scent associated with your purpose, and youâll be reminded of your goal each time you detect that particular aroma.
